Ebooks
can be accessed through the Library Book catalog. Go to http://www.redwoods.edu/eureka/Library/
and select the link, "Search for Books." Choose "Title Beginning
Words" from the box on the right. Click into the box on the left and type
in the first few words of the title. Press enter or click the
"Search" button. Click on the link in the book record that says,
"Bibliographic record display An electronic book
accessible through the World Wide Web; click for information" and you will
see the NetLibrary record for the book. You can then browse thru the book page
by page or use the table of contents in the left pane. There is also a
"search within this book" feature. You must be using an on-campus
computer to access NetLibrary Ebooks. To access from off-campus computers, you
must first connect to NetLibrary from an on-campus computer, look for the link
in the upper right hand corner that says, "Create
a Free Account." You will need to fill out a brief registration form and
create a username and password, which you can then use to access the NetLibrary
ebooks from your home computer. Call me if you have any questions.
